Aborn, Peter – Bulletin of the American Society for Information Science, 1979
Outlines how an information company--the Institute for Scientific Information (ISI)--designed a new building to house its facility. Problems and deficiencies in the old work space were analyzed using a rigorous systems approach, and an open-plan system was devised to allow for optimum space utilization and energy efficiency. Wells, Marianna; Young, Rosemary – Special Libraries, 1994
Provides a blueprint of details to consider and actions to undertake when planning and moving a library. It examines space needs, spatial design elements, requirements for reader stations, collections, and new technology; provides suggestions for master planning and siting; and gives tips on how to successfully move into a new facility.
